AC_INIT(slat, 1.2.6)

AC_CONFIG_SRCDIR(src/formula/formula.c)

AM_INIT_AUTOMAKE

AC_PROG_MAKE_SET

AC_PROG_INSTALL

AC_PROG_RANLIB

AC_PROG_CC

dnl Add warning when using GGG
if test "X$GCC" = Xyes ; then
  CFLAGS="$CFLAGS -Wall"
fi

AC_PROG_CXX

dnl Add warning when using G++
if test "X$GXX" = Xyes ; then
  CXXFLAGS="$CXXFLAGS -Wall"
fi

AM_PROG_LEX

AC_PROG_YACC

# AM_PROG_GCJ

AC_CHECK_PROG(latex, [pdflatex], [yes])

AM_CONDITIONAL(LATEX, [test "X$latex" = Xyes])

# the script generated by autoconf from this input will set the following
# variables:
#   OCAMLC        "ocamlc" if present in the path, or a failure
#                 or "ocamlc.opt" if present with same version number as ocamlc
#   OCAMLOPT      "ocamlopt" (or "ocamlopt.opt" if present), or "no"
#   OCAMLBEST     either "byte" if no native compiler was found, 
#                 or "opt" otherwise
#   OCAMLDEP      "ocamldep"
#   OCAMLLEX      "ocamllex" (or "ocamllex.opt" if present)
#   OCAMLYACC     "ocamlyac"
#   OCAMLLIB      the path to the ocaml standard library
#   OCAMLVERSION  the ocaml version number
#   OCAMLWEB      "ocamlweb" (not mandatory)
#   OCAMLWIN32    "yes"/"no" depending on Sys.os_type = "Win32"

# Check for Ocaml compilers

# we first look for ocamlc in the path; if not present, we fail
A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LC,ocamlc,ocamlc,no)
if test "$OCAMLC" = no ; then
	AC_MSG_ERROR(Cannot find ocamlc.)
fi

# we extract Ocaml version number and library path
OCAMLVERSION=`$OCAMLC -v | sed -n -e 's|.*version *\(.*\)$|\1|p' `
echo "ocaml version is $OCAMLVERSION"
OCAMLLIB=`$OCAMLC -v | tail -1 | cut -f 4 -d " "`
echo "ocaml library path is $OCAMLLIB"

# then we look for ocamlopt; if not present, we don't warn for slat
# because it only uses bytecode compilation.  If the version is not
# the same, we also discard it we set OCAMLBEST to "opt" or "byte",
# whether ocamlopt is available or not.
A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LOPT,ocamlopt,ocamlopt,no)
OCAMLBEST=byte

if test "$OCAMLOPT" != no ; then
	AC_MSG_CHECKING(ocamlopt version)
	TMPVERSION=`$OCAMLOPT -v | sed -n -e 's|.*version *\(.*\)$|\1|p' `
	if test "$TMPVERSION" != "$OCAMLVERSION" ; then
	    AC_MSG_RESULT(differs from ocamlc; ocamlopt discarded.)
	    OCAMLOPT=no
	else
	    AC_MSG_RESULT(ok)
	    OCAMLBEST=opt
	fi
fi

# checking for ocamlc.opt
A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LCDOTOPT,ocamlc.opt,ocamlc.opt,no)
if test "$OCAMLCDOTOPT" != no ; then
	AC_MSG_CHECKING(ocamlc.opt version)
	TMPVERSION=`$OCAMLCDOTOPT -v | sed -n -e 's|.*version *\(.*\)$|\1|p' `
	if test "$TMPVERSION" != "$OCAMLVERSION" ; then
	    AC_MSG_RESULT(differs from ocamlc; ocamlc.opt discarded.)
	else
	    AC_MSG_RESULT(ok)
	    OCAMLC=$OCAMLCDOTOPT
	fi
fi

# checking for ocamlopt.opt
if test "$OCAMLOPT" != no ; then
    A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LOPTDOTOPT,ocamlopt.opt,ocamlopt.opt,no)
    if test "$OCAMLOPTDOTOPT" != no ; then
	AC_MSG_CHECKING(ocamlc.opt version)
	TMPVER=`$OCAMLOPTDOTOPT -v | sed -n -e 's|.*version *\(.*\)$|\1|p' `
	if test "$TMPVER" != "$OCAMLVERSION" ; then
	    AC_MSG_RESULT(differs from ocamlc; ocamlopt.opt discarded.)
	else
	    AC_MSG_RESULT(ok)
	    OCAMLOPT=$OCAMLOPTDOTOPT
	fi
    fi
fi

# ocamldep, ocamllex and ocamlyacc should also be present in the path
A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LDEP,ocamldep,ocamldep,no)
if test "$OCAMLDEP" = no ; then
	AC_MSG_ERROR(Cannot find ocamldep.)
fi

A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LLEX,ocamllex,ocamllex,no)
if test "$OCAMLLEX" = no ; then
    AC_MSG_ERROR(Cannot find ocamllex.)
else
    A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LLEXDOTOPT,ocamllex.opt,ocamllex.opt,no)
    if test "$OCAMLLEXDOTOPT" != no ; then
	OCAMLLEX=$OCAMLLEXDOTOPT
    fi
fi

A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LYACC,ocamlyacc,ocamlyacc,no)
if test "$OCAMLYACC" = no ; then
	AC_MSG_ERROR(Cannot find ocamlyacc.)
fi

AC_CHECK_PROG(OCAMLWEB,ocamlweb,ocamlweb,true)

# platform
AC_MSG_CHECKING(platform)
if echo "let _ = Sys.os_type" | ocaml | grep -q Win32; then
    AC_MSG_RESULT(Win32)
    OCAMLWIN32=yes
else
    OCAMLWIN32=no
fi

# substitutions to perform
AC_SUBST(OCAMLC)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LOPT)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LDEP)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LLEX)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LYACC)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LBEST)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LVERSION)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LLIB)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LWEB)
AC_SUBST(OCAMLWIN32)

AC_CONFIG_FILES([Makefile VERSION slat.spec 
    ml/Makefile ml/print_version.ml
    src/Makefile info/Makefile doc/Makefile
    src/formula/Makefile src/slat/Makefile 
    src/lts2smv/Makefile src/poldecond/Makefile])

AC_OUTPUT
